**Wordings Specialist**

Sydney/Melbourne

Our International Wordings team has an exciting opportunity for an ambitious and adaptable individual to join them as a Wordings Specialist. You will be an integral part of the team and the wider Legal department supporting the underwriting business across all product lines covering a wide variety of complex risks. You will have the opportunity to demonstrate your technical drafting skills and advisory services to the underwriters, their clients and brokers in order to provide a service differentiator for AXA XL.

**DISCOVER your opportunity**

What will your essential responsibilities include?
- Analysing - reviewing our existing products, new products and those of our competitors, including analysis and explanation of individual clauses right through to entire product wordings, always with a focus on delivering a timely and commercial solution to any issue raised;
- Creating & Innovating - working closely with key stakeholders to build new insurance products from scratch or refine or expand existing products, leading innovation for the AXA XL brand;
- Teamwork - collaborating with colleagues across the Wordings team, the wider Legal Department and beyond (Claims, Compliance, Conduct Risk) in order to deliver on team goals, service delivery requirements and internal projects Training and Developing - sharing best practice solutions across the wider business, delivering presentations to underwriting teams, providing pre-bind and post-bind technical wording advice;
- Supporting underwriters in achieving underwriting discipline both through coverage analysis and offering robust and clear wording solutions and highlighting potential coverage exposure to emerging risks.

You will report to the Wordings Manager based in Europe, with support from local Legal & Compliance in Sydney.

**SHARE your talent**

Does this sound like you?
- Ability to interpret and analyse insurance clause and/or wording requests and to satisfy these by drafting your own insurance clauses and wordings from scratch in a clear and robust manner (in English).
- Confidence to deliver group driven wording mandates alongside your own wording solutions to underwriters, brokers and peers both in writing and face to face.
- A comprehensive understanding of what the business, legal and compliance needs are for individual insurance classes.
- An in-depth understanding of standard clauses used in the Australian market and class-specific wording structures.
- An ability to plan and self-manage workload and work under pressure whilst adhering to deadlines and competing priorities.
- An ability to work both as part of a team and independently with little or no supervision and to exercise independent judgement.
- Demonstrable wordings experience in the Australian market and proven record of working in depth with insurance wordings. Experience of working on wholesale / commercial wordings preferred, but not essential.
